I just have wired the digital between LC-1 (firmware v1.20) and S300 v2. All OK, except that the units are not right:
- on the laptop (Windows 7) used to update calibration and datalog: the AFR from digital input is twice as low as analog input from B6. The output from LC-1 is OK, because Logworks in a PC shows AFR properly.
- after opening the same calibration and datalog on a Windows 8 desktop PC - the units for digital input is volts here (why volts? from digital input? why not possible to change?). and no way to change. Value seems to be ~0.5 and follows AFR changes seen on B6 input. It's just wrong unit and no way to change.
- SManager 2.2.7
- ECU is P28-A01
